How to Make Money with Affiliate Programs
Affiliate marketing programs are great for both affiliate marketers and the merchants who offer them. If you've never tried affiliate marketing because it seems like just one more scam, you should know that it's a valid method of making money, it's very legal, not a pyramid scheme, and many people make extra money to help subsidize their regular income or even to the point of being their main income.
Unlike some "programs' you'll find online, you don't have to pay anyone or company to sign up and get started. You won't be expected to recruit others into the program and your commissions are only dependent on your own efforts.
Affiliate Marketing Programs have several advantages over other ways to make money online:
Minor expenses for a website or online store
No inventory to keep or ship
No credit card processing to apply
Your affiliate merchants will take care of all these details. All you have to do is promote their website and/or products. Once someone clicks your link to the merchant's site, you've done your job. You then start benefiting from that particular website's salesmanship. They already have tactics and techniques to help convince someone to buy their product or service. Once a purchase is made you will start earning your affiliate commission.
Try to build your website around a niche that is interesting to you. You don't have to be a writer to convey your ideas or products to your site visitors, you just need an affiliate marketer that you feel comfortable working with and enjoy their products.
